一列时间数据 输出指定时间段的行
时间: 2023-04-10 20:03:20 浏览: 75
非常感谢您的提问,以下是回答:
如果您有一列时间数据,您可以使用 Pandas 库来筛选指定时间段的行。假设您的时间数据列名为 "time",您可以使用以下代码来筛选 2021 年 1 月 1 日到 2021 年 1 月 31 日之间的行:
```python
import pandas as pd
# 读取数据
df = pd.read_csv("your_data.csv")
# 将时间列转换为 datetime 类型
df["time"] = pd.to_datetime(df["time"])
# 筛选指定时间段的行
start_time = pd.Timestamp("2021-01-01")
end_time = pd.Timestamp("2021-01-31")
selected_rows = df[(df["time"] >= start_time) & (df["time"] <= end_time)]
```
请注意,以上代码仅供参考,具体实现可能需要根据您的数据格式和需求进行调整。
相关问题
一列时间的数据 挑选处任何时间段的数据
我可以为您提供一个程序来帮助您挑选出任何时间段的数据。您可以使用Python编写一个程序,使用pandas库来读取时间数据,并使用datetime库来处理时间。以下是一个示例程序:
```python
import pandas as pd
from datetime import datetime
# 读取时间数据
data = pd.read_csv('time_data.csv')
# 将时间列转换为datetime类型
data['time'] = pd.to_datetime(data['time'])
# 输入起始时间和结束时间
start_time = input('请输入起始时间(格式为YYYY-MM-DD HH:MM:SS):')
end_time = input('请输入结束时间(格式为YYYY-MM-DD HH:MM:SS):')
# 将输入的时间转换为datetime类型
start_time = datetime.strptime(start_time, '%Y-%m-%d %H:%M:%S')
end_time = datetime.strptime(end_time, '%Y-%m-%d %H:%M:%S')
# 挑选出指定时间段的数据
selected_data = data[(data['time'] >= start_time) & (data['time'] <= end_time)]
# 输出挑选出的数据
print(selected_data)
```
请注意,这只是一个示例程序,您需要根据您的具体数据格式和需求进行修改。
Python代码实现一列中按照相同的时间,计算相同时间对应的F4的均值,并将时间及对应的均值输出为新的Excel
好的,这是一个比较具体的问题,我可以为您提供一些思路和示例代码。
首先,您需要使用Python的pandas库来读取Excel文件,并进行数据处理和计算。假设您的数据表格中有两列,一列是时间(假设是“Time”列),另一列是F4数据(假设是“F4”列),那么您可以这样实现计算均值的代码: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('your_file_path.xlsx')
# 按照时间分组,计算F4均值
grouped = df.groupby('Time')['F4'].mean()
# 将时间和均值输出为新的Excel文件
grouped.to_excel('output_file_path.xlsx')
```
这段代码中,首先使用pandas的read_excel函数读取Excel文件,将其转换为DataFrame对象。然后使用groupby函数按照时间分组,并对每个分组中的F4数据计算均值。最后使用to_excel函数将时间和均值输出为新的Excel文件。
需要注意的是,您需要将“your_file_path.xlsx”和“output_file_path.xlsx”替换为您自己的文件路径。另外,如果您的Excel文件中有多个工作表,需要使用sheet_name参数指定要读取的工作表名称。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)